Invesco Ltd., founded in 1978 and head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, is a global investment management firm managing hundreds of billions in assets across a diverse range of products, including mutual funds, exchange-traded funds (ETFs), and institutional portfolios. Known for its blend of active and passive investment strategies, Invesco serves individual investors, financial advisors, and institutions, with a strong presence in North America, Europe, and Asia, bolstered by acquisitions like OppenheimerFunds in 2019. The firm offers specialized solutions in equities, fixed income, real estate, and alternatives, leveraging its global research capabilities to cater to varying market needs. Invesco’s commitment to innovation and client-focused investing has solidified its reputation as a versatile player in the asset management industry.

Invesco's Q4 2021 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2021, Invesco held 4,196 positions worth $415B, up 5.1% from $395B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 12% of the portfolio.

Invesco's Q4 2021 filing shows 190 new, 1,645 increased, 2,044 reduced and 170 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Grab: 44,484,753 shares worth $317M. The largest sale was Meta Platforms (Facebook), an estimated $867M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 22% of assets, up from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
